Study On The Law Of Cr(?) Migration In Red Mud Leachate In Compacted Clay Liner

When the artificial impervious layer(geotextile and HDPE membrane)of the red mud yard is damaged or failed,the leachate of the red mud yard will directly penetrate into the compacted clay liner,and then cause pollution to the groundwater.Therefore,it is necessary to study the law of Cr(?)migration in red mud leachate in compacted clay liner to prevent further pollution of Cr(?)to groundwater.At present,a lot of research has been done on the seepage control of landfill leachate at home and abroad.However,there was little research on the migration law of pollutants from strongly alkaline red mud leachate in impervious layer,especially on its impact on the impervious performance of compacted clay liner.In this paper,bentonite was selected as compacted clay liner material.Red mud leachate was taken from a red mud yard.The physical and chemical properties of red mud leachate and compacted clay were studied.The influence of red mud leachate on the permeability characteristics of compacted clay liner and its erosion mechanism were studied by permeability test and scanning electron microscope.The adsorption characteristics of Cr(?)in compacted clay were studied by soil column penetration test.The mathematical model was established and solved by Hydrus-1D.The migration law of Cr(?)in red mud leachate in compacted clay liner was studied.The specific research results were as follows:(1)The p H of red mud leachate was 12.6.The concentration of Na+in red mud leachate was 12500mg/L.The concentration of Cr(?)was 1.76 mg/L.Al in red mud leachate exists in the form of Al(OH)4-.(2)Through infiltration test,the permeability coefficient of compacted clay was5.43×10-11m/s with red mud leachate as infiltration solution.The permeability coefficient meets the anti-seepage requirement that the saturated permeability coefficient of compacted clay should not be greater than 1.0×10-7cm/s in the Standard for Pollution Control of Storage and Landfill of General Industrial Solid Waste(GB18599-2020).Through scanning electron microscope and energy spectrum analysis,the dissolution and adsorption reaction between compacted clay and leachate were occurred.Red mud leachate has a great erosion degree on clay particles.The chemical compatibility between red mud leachate and compacted clay was poor.(3)Through the soil column test,the concentration of Cr(?)in effluent reached 93%of the initial concentration when the adsorption saturation time reached 146d.It takes a long time for Cr(?)in red mud leachate to completely penetrate the compacted clay.Compacted clay liner has a better effect on blocking Cr(?)in red mud leachate.Logistic penetration model,Thomas model and Yoon-Nelson model could well fit the penetration process.The adsorption of Cr(?)by clay at different p H values was simulated by Visual MINTEQ.The adsorption effect of clay on Cr(?)is better under alkaline condition,which shows that compacted clay liner can effectively block the downward migration of Cr(?)in red mud leachate,thus verifying the blocking effect of compacted clay liner on Cr(?)in soil column test.(4)Hydrus-1D was used to simulate the migration of Cr(?)in compacted clay liner.At 7813d(21.4a),the content of Cr(?)seeped from the bottom of compacted clay liner was0.0498 mg/L.According to Groundwater Quality Standard(GB/T14848-2017),when the leakage time exceeded 7813d,the content of Cr(?)leaked from the bottom of compacted clay liner was higher than the limit of Class III standard of groundwater quality,and then the compacted clay liner failed.
